Ingredients for Lemon Zucchini Scones:

Embrace the vibrant flavors of Lemon Zucchini Scones with this delightful recipe. These scones perfectly balance the tanginess of lemon with the subtle sweetness of zucchini, making them ideal for breakfast or an afternoon snack.

Dry Ingredients:

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our (240 g)
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ar (50 g)
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

Wet Ingredients:

  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, cold and cubed (113 g)
  • 1 cup finely grated zucchini, squeezed to remove excess moisture (120 g)
  • 1/2 cup buttermilk (120 ml)
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Zest of 1 large lemon

Optional Glaze:

  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ar (60 g)
  • 1–2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ice

How to Prepare Lemon Zucchini Scones:

Start by preheating your oven to 400°F (200°C). In a large mixing bowl, combine the dry ingredients: all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Whisk together until well blended. Next, add cold, cubed unsalted butter to the dry mixture. Using your fingertips or a pastry cutter, mix until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Then, gently fold in the finely grated zucchini and lemon zest.

In a separate bowl, whisk together the buttermilk, egg, and vanilla extract. Gradually pour this wet mixture into the dry ingredients, stirring just until comb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this can make the scones tough.

Scoop the dough onto a baking sheet lined with parchment paper, shaping it into scones. Bake for 15–20 minutes or until golden brown. For a delightful finish, consider adding a glaze made from powdered sugar and fresh lemon juice.

Tips for Perfecting Lemon Zucchini Scones:

Achieving the perfect Lemon Zucchini Scones requires a few simple yet effective tips. First, use fresh zucchini for a moist texture. Grate it finely and wring out excess moisture with a clean towel before adding it to your mix. This step ensures your scones don’t become soggy. Additionally, opt for high-quality lemon zest to amplify the citrus flavor—don’t skimp on it!

Another key tip is to avoid over-mixing your dough. Gently combine the ingredients just until they are incorporated; this helps maintain the scone’s light and fluffy texture. Storage Tips for Lemon Zucchini Scones:

To keep your Lemon Zucchini Scones fresh, store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. For longer storage, consider freezing them; simply wrap each scone in plastic wrap and place them in a freezer-safe bag. When ready to enjoy, thaw and reheat. How do you make lemon zucchini scones moist?

Moisture in lemon zucchini scones primarily comes from the shredded zucchini. Ensure you squeeze out excess water from the zucchini before mixing, as this controls the moisture balance. Using cold butter and not over-mixing the dough also contributes to a tender texture.

Can lemon zucchini scones be frozen?

Absolutely! To freeze lemon zucchini scones, bake them first and let them cool. Then, wrap them individually in plastic wrap and place them in an airtight container. When ready to enjoy, simply thaw and reheat.

Instructions

  •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
  • Cut in the cold butter until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
  • Stir in the grated zucchini, followed by the buttermilk, egg, vanilla extract, and lemon zest until just combined.
  • Turn the dough out onto a floured surface and knead gently until it comes together.
  • Pat the dough into a circle about 1 inch thick and cut into triangles or wedges.
  • Place the scones on the prepared baking sheet and bake for 25-30 minutes or until golden brown.
  • While the scones are baking, make the glaze by whisking together the powdered sugar and lemon juice until smooth.
  • Drizzle the glaze over the warm scones once they are out of the oven. Serve and enjoy!

Notes

Make sure to remove excess moisture from the zucchini to avoid soggy scones. The glaze is optional but adds a delightful sweetness.
